The Integrated Rural Development Program (IRDP) was launched by the Government of India during 1978 and implemented during 1980.
The main objective of 'Integrated Rural Development Programme' was training for Rural Youths.
The aim of the program is to provide employment opportunities to the poor as well as opportunities to develop their skill sets so as to improve their living conditions.
The program is considered one of the best yojana's to do away with poverty-related problems by offering those who fell below the poverty line the necessary subsidies in tandem with employment opportunities.
